What Does a Home Insurance Agent in Niskayuna Cost?
In New York the average annual home insurance premium is around 1,300 to 2,500 dollars for a standard policy. Costs in Niskayuna may be higher due to local flood and winter storm risks. Factors like home age, coverage amount, and deductible affect your final price. This is general information and not insurance advice.

What does a home insurance agent in Niskayuna do?
A home insurance agent helps you find a policy that covers your home and belongings. They explain coverage limits and deductibles. They also assist with claims and policy changes.
Is flood insurance required in Niskayuna New York?
Flood insurance is not required by New York state law. However mortgage lenders may require it if your home is in a high risk flood zone. Many Niskayuna properties near the Mohawk River may need this coverage.
How do I choose a home insurance agent in Niskayuna?
Look for an agent licensed in New York who has experience with local property types. Ask about their knowledge of Schenectady County building codes and weather risks. Compare quotes from multiple agents before deciding.
